Skip to content

Commit

Permalink
Fix styles in preto jdbc
Browse files Browse the repository at this point in the history
  • Loading branch information
Flávio Ferreira committed Oct 7, 2016
1 parent 16cf405 commit 9e6e550
Show file tree
Hide file tree
Showing 2 changed files with 16 additions and 11 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-204,20 +204,27 @@ public void setObject(int parameterIndex, Object x, int targetSqlType)
public void setObject(int parameterIndex, Object x)
throws SQLException
{
if (x instanceof String)
if (x instanceof String) {
sql = sql.replaceFirst("([?])", "'" + x.toString() + "'");
else if (x instanceof BigDecimal)
setBigDecimal(parameterIndex, (BigDecimal)x);
else if (x instanceof Short)
}
else if (x instanceof BigDecimal) {
setBigDecimal(parameterIndex, (BigDecimal) x);
}
else if (x instanceof Short) {
setShort(parameterIndex, (Short) x);
else if (x instanceof Integer)
}
else if (x instanceof Integer) {
setInt(parameterIndex, (Integer) x);
else if (x instanceof Long)
}
else if (x instanceof Long) {
setLong(parameterIndex, (Long) x);
else if (x instanceof Float)
}
else if (x instanceof Float) {
setFloat(parameterIndex, (Float) x);
else if (x instanceof Double)
}
else if (x instanceof Double) {
setDouble(parameterIndex, (Double) x);
}
}

@Override
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,6 @@
import com.google.common.collect.ImmutableSet;
import io.airlift.log.Logging;
import io.airlift.units.Duration;
import java.sql.PreparedStatement;
import org.joda.time.DateTime;
import org.joda.time.DateTimeZone;
import org.testng.annotations.AfterClass;
Expand All @@ -50,6 +49,7 @@
import java.sql.Connection;
import java.sql.Date;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.ResultSetMetaData;
import java.sql.SQLException;
Expand Down Expand Up @@ -1049,7 +1049,6 @@ public void testExecutePreparedWithQuery()
{
try (Connection connection = createConnection()) {
try (PreparedStatement statement = connection.prepareStatement("SELECT ? as param1StringValue, ? as param2NumberValue")) {

statement.clearParameters();
statement.setObject(1, "foo");
statement.setObject(2, 123);
Expand Down Expand Up @@ -1089,7 +1088,6 @@ public void testExecutePreparedWithQueryWithNullValues()
{
try (Connection connection = createConnection()) {
try (PreparedStatement statement = connection.prepareStatement("SELECT ? as param1StringValue")) {

statement.clearParameters();

ResultSet rs = statement.executeQuery();
Expand Down

0 comments on commit 9e6e550

Please sign in to comment.